UpdateRun interface
En process i flera steg för att utföra uppdateringsåtgärder för medlemmar i en flotta.
- Extends
Egenskaper
e |
Om eTag anges i svarstexten kan det också anges som en rubrik enligt den normala etag-konventionen. Entitetstaggar används för att jämföra två eller flera entiteter från samma begärda resurs. HTTP/1.1 använder entitetstaggar i etag (avsnitt 14.19), If-Match (avsnitt 14.24), If-None-Match (avsnitt 14.26) och If-Range (avsnitt 14.27) rubrikfält.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ern. |
managed |
Uppdateringen som ska tillämpas på alla kluster i UpdateRun. ManagedClusterUpdate kan ändras tills körningen startas. |
provisioning |
Etableringstillståndet för UpdateRun-resursen.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ern. |
status | Status för UpdateRun.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ern. |
strategy | Strategin definierar i vilken ordning klustren ska uppdateras. Om det inte anges uppdateras alla medlemmar sekventiellt. UpdateRun-statusen visar en enda UpdateStage och en enda UpdateGroup för alla medlemmar. Strategin för UpdateRun kan ändras tills körningen startas. |
update |
Resurs-ID för FleetUpdateStrategy-resursen som ska refereras. När du skapar en ny körning finns det tre sätt att definiera en strategi för körningen:
Det är ogiltigt att ange både "updateStrategyId" och "strategi". UpdateRuns som skapats av ögonblicksbilden "updateStrategyId" refererade till UpdateStrategy när den skapades och lagrar den i fältet "strategi". Efterföljande ändringar av den refererade FleetUpdateStrategy-resursen sprids inte. UpdateRunStrategy-ändringar kan göras direkt i fältet "strategi" innan du startar UpdateRun. |
Ärvda egenskaper
id | Fullständigt kvalificerat resurs-ID för resursen. Exempel – /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} Obs! Den här egenskapen kommer inte att serialiseras. Den kan bara fyllas i av servern. |
name | Namnet på resursen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ern. |
system |
Azure Resource Manager metadata som innehåller createdBy och modifiedBy-information.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ern. |
type | Resurstypen. T.ex. "Microsoft.Compute/virtualMachines" eller "Microsoft.Storage/storageAccounts" OBS! Den här egenskapen kommer inte att serialiseras. Den kan bara fyllas i av servern. |
Egenskapsinformation
eTag
Om eTag anges i svarstexten kan det också anges som en rubrik enligt den normala etag-konventionen. Entitetstaggar används för att jämföra två eller flera entiteter från samma begärda resurs. HTTP/1.1 använder entitetstaggar i etag (avsnitt 14.19), If-Match (avsnitt 14.24), If-None-Match (avsnitt 14.26) och If-Range (avsnitt 14.27) rubrikfält.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ern.
eTag?: string
Egenskapsvärde
string
managedClusterUpdate
Uppdateringen som ska tillämpas på alla kluster i UpdateRun. ManagedClusterUpdate kan ändras tills körningen startas.
managedClusterUpdate?: ManagedClusterUpdate
Egenskapsvärde
provisioningState
Etableringstillståndet för UpdateRun-resursen.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ern.
provisioningState?: string
Egenskapsvärde
string
status
Status för UpdateRun.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ern.
status?: UpdateRunStatus
Egenskapsvärde
strategy
Strategin definierar i vilken ordning klustren ska uppdateras. Om det inte anges uppdateras alla medlemmar sekventiellt. UpdateRun-statusen visar en enda UpdateStage och en enda UpdateGroup för alla medlemmar. Strategin för UpdateRun kan ändras tills körningen startas.
strategy?: UpdateRunStrategy
Egenskapsvärde
updateStrategyId
Resurs-ID för FleetUpdateStrategy-resursen som ska refereras.
När du skapar en ny körning finns det tre sätt att definiera en strategi för körningen:
- Definiera en ny strategi: Ange fältet "strategi".
- Använd en befintlig strategi: Ange fältet "updateStrategyId". (sedan 2023-08-15-preview)
- Använd standardstrategin för att uppdatera alla medlemmar en i taget: Lämna både "updateStrategyId" och "strategi" oetiga. (sedan 2023-08-15-preview)
Det är ogiltigt att ange både "updateStrategyId" och "strategi".
UpdateRuns som skapats av ögonblicksbilden "updateStrategyId" refererade till UpdateStrategy när den skapades och lagrar den i fältet "strategi". Efterföljande ändringar av den refererade FleetUpdateStrategy-resursen sprids inte. UpdateRunStrategy-ändringar kan göras direkt i fältet "strategi" innan du startar UpdateRun.
updateStrategyId?: string
Egenskapsvärde
string
Information om ärvda egenskaper
id
Fullständigt kvalificerat resurs-ID för resursen. Exempel – /sub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/{resourceProviderNamespace}/{resourceType}/{resourceName} Obs! Den här egenskapen kommer inte att serialiseras. Den kan bara fyllas i av servern.
id?: string
Egenskapsvärde
string
Ärvd frånProxyResource.id
name
Namnet på resursen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ern.
name?: string
Egenskapsvärde
string
Ärvd frånProxyResource.name
systemData
Azure Resource Manager metadata som innehåller createdBy och modifiedBy-information. Obs! Den här egenskapen serialiseras inte. Den kan bara fyllas i av servern.
systemData?: SystemData
Egenskapsvärde
Ärvd frånProxyResource.systemData
type
Resurstypen. T.ex. "Microsoft.Compute/virtualMachines" eller "Microsoft.Storage/storageAccounts" OBS! Den här egenskapen kommer inte att serialiseras. Den kan bara fyllas i av servern.
type?: string
Egenskapsvärde
string
Ärvd frånProxyResource.type